How To Write Resume For Physician’s Assistant

  • Highlight your clinical experience and skills in the objective statement and throughout the resume.
  • Quantify your accomplishments whenever possible, using specific numbers and metrics to demonstrate your impact.
  • Tailor your resume to each job you apply for, emphasizing the skills and experience that are most relevant to the position.
  • Proofread your resume carefully for any errors before submitting it.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’s) For Physician’s Assistant

  • What is the role of a Physician Assistant?

    A Physician Assistant (PA) is a healthcare professional who is trained to provide medical care under the supervision of a physician. PAs perform a wide range of duties, including taking medical histories, performing physical exams, diagnosing and treating illnesses, prescribing medications, and assisting in surgery.

  • What are the educational requirements to become a Physician Assistant?

    To become a Physician Assistant, you must complete a Master’s Degree in Physician Assistant Studies from an accredited program. The program typically takes 2-3 years to complete and includes coursework in anatomy, physiology, pharmacology, and clinical medicine.

  • What is the salary range for Physician Assistants?

    The salary range for Physician Assistants varies depending on experience, location, and employer. According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ual salary for Physician Assistants was $112,260 in May 2019.
